Star Wars hidden in your Mac!

To celebrate this year's Star Wars day I thought I would share one of my favourite terminal tricks with you. As a huge fan of George Lucas' cinematic masterpiece Star Wars and a bit of an Apple geek finding something that brings together my love of Sci-Fi and terminal based code is something special.So here it is. Open up a terminal window by pressing ⌘ + spacebar to bring up a finder search and tap in 'terminal' and run the app. Once the app has loaded you should be faced with a screen that looks something like the one below.

Then all you have to do is to simply type the command below, wait a few moments and then Star Wars: A New Hope will begin to play on your screen in punctuation characters.

telnet towel.blinkenlights.nl

The same also works in command prompt on Windows.
